Manor House at Samara
DESCRIPTION
The 5 star Samara Manor House is located in the malaria-free Samara Private Game Reserve which is surrounded by the panoramic Karoo mountain landscape. The House is visited by eland, buffalo, aardvark and giraffe. The Manor House is the private home of the owners and boasts a traditional homestead feel. The nearest town is Graaff-Reinet.
The rooms can sleep up to 8 adults or 6 adults and 4 children. The 4 suites enjoy greater privacy, each with their own patio and spacious bathroom with a free-standing bathtub and separate shower.
The open plan living space boasts a cosy lounge, 2 reading nooks, bar, fireplace and television. The dining room seats up to 10 guests and the house's glass doors open on to the patio from the living area, providing views of the infinity swimming pool, active water-hole and the Karoo wilderness.
Dinner is served at the Boma where traditional cuisine is enjoyed under the African sky. A variety of indoor and al fresco dining options are available to guests. The services of a personal game ranger, chef and butler are available to guests.
Activities include guided sunrise and sunset game drives, cheetah tracking and visits to the rock art and fossil sites.
